How to Make Marry Me Chicken
Now that you have all your ingredients ready, let’s dive into the cooking process! Making Marry Me Chicken is straightforward and fun. Follow these simple steps, and you’ll have a delicious meal in no time.
Step 1: Season the Chicken
Start by seasoning the chicken breasts with salt and pepper on both sides. This simple step enhances the chicken’s natural flavors. Don’t be shy—season generously! It’s the foundation of a tasty dish.
Step 2: Cook the Chicken
In a large skillet, heat up the olive oil over medium-high heat. Once the oil is shimmering, carefully add the seasoned chicken breasts. Cook them for about 5-7 minutes on each side. You want them golden brown and cooked through. When done, remove the chicken from the skillet and set it aside. This step is crucial for that perfect texture!
Step 3: Sauté Aromatics
In the same skillet, toss in the minced garlic, Italian seasoning, and red pepper flakes. Sauté for about a minute until fragrant. The aroma will fill your kitchen, making it hard to resist! This is where the magic begins, as the flavors start to meld together.
Step 4: Create the Sauce
Next, stir in the chopped sun-dried tomatoes and heavy cream. Bring the mixture to a gentle simmer. This creamy Tuscan chicken sauce is where the dish gets its richness. Keep stirring until everything is well combined and heated through.
Step 5: Add Cheese
Now, it’s time to add the grated Parmesan cheese. Stir it in until it melts and creates a smooth, creamy sauce. This cheesy goodness is what makes Marry Me Chicken so irresistible. You’ll want to taste it at this point—just a little, of course!
Step 6: Combine and Finish
Return the chicken to the skillet and add the fresh spinach. Cook for an additional 2-3 minutes, or until the spinach wilts. This final step brings everything together, creating a beautiful, colorful dish. Serve hot, garnished with fresh basil for that extra touch!

PrintMarry Me Chicken: A Delicious Recipe to Wow Anyone!
- Total Time: 30 minutes
- Yield: 4 servings 1x
- Diet: Gluten Free
Description
Marry Me Chicken is a creamy and flavorful dish that combines tender chicken breasts with sun-dried tomatoes, spinach, and a rich Parmesan cream sauce, perfect for impressing anyone.
Ingredients
- 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
- Salt and pepper, to taste
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 4 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
- 1/2 teaspoon red pepper flakes (optional)
- 1 cup sun-dried tomatoes, chopped
- 1 cup heavy cream
- 1 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 1 cup fresh spinach
- Fresh basil, for garnish
Instructions
- Season the chicken breasts with salt and pepper on both sides.
- In a large skillet, heat olive oil over medium-high heat. Add the chicken breasts and cook for 5-7 minutes on each side, or until golden brown and cooked through. Remove the chicken from the skillet and set aside.
- In the same skillet, add minced garlic, Italian seasoning, and red pepper flakes. Sauté for about 1 minute until fragrant.
- Stir in the sun-dried tomatoes and heavy cream, bringing the mixture to a simmer.
- Add the grated Parmesan cheese, stirring until melted and smooth.
- Return the chicken to the skillet and add the fresh spinach. Cook for an additional 2-3 minutes, or until the spinach is wilted and the chicken is heated through.
- Serve hot, garnished with fresh basil.
Notes
- For a spicier dish, increase the amount of red pepper flakes.
- This dish pairs well with pasta or rice.
- Leftovers can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
